The ADG1712 from Analog Devices integrates four independent CMOS single-pole, single-throw (SPST) switches capable of operating from low-voltage single supplies of +1.08 to +5.5V or dual supplies of ±1.08 to ±2.75V.
Each switch offers rail-to-rail signal handling, allowing bidirectional conduction with minimal distortion while switching analog or digital signals.
With a typical on-resistance of 2.4Ω, the ADG1712 minimises insertion loss and ensures accurate signal transmission.
Logic inputs are compatible with both 1.8 and 3.3V JEDEC-standard logic, enabling seamless integration with microcontrollers and field-programmable gate arrays (FPGAs). Designed in a compact 16-lead, 2 x 2mm LGA package, this device achieves high performance without occupying excessive printed-circuit board (PCB) area.
Engineered for precision applications, the ADG1712 supports operation over a wide temperature range from -40 to +125°C, making it reliable in industrial, automotive, and instrumentation environments.
Applications include automated test and measurement systems, data acquisition front-ends, medical instrumentation, FPGA and microcontroller-controlled signal routing, audio/video signal muxing or relay replacement and communication systems requiring compact, low-loss switching.
